No, there is no direct bus from Bottrop to Schwerte. However, there are services departing from BOT ZOB Berliner Platz and arriving at Schwerte, Hastingsallee via Essen central train station and Dortmund Hörde Bf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 35m.
No, there is no direct train from Bottrop to Schwerte. However, there are services departing from Bottrop Hbf and arriving at Schwerte, Bahnhof via Essen Hbf and Dortmund Hbf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 25m.
The distance between Bottrop and Schwerte is 64 km. The road distance is 60.5 km.
